What is a Madeline chair?
1 Answer

A Madeline chair is a type of upholstered chair commonly used in seating areas. A take on the barrel chair, it features a low-profile rolled back and a deep, narrow seat. Typically, it rests on simple, squared wooden legs. On 1stDibs, shop a diverse assortment of armchairs.
